d1d8deee2cf9ae25eefaea2e7231e27dcbaeebc6
Files Diff
- Added: 1
- Removed: 0
- Renamed: 0
- Modified: 5
Refactorings reported:
Refactoring Name | Occurences | ||
---|---|---|---|
Change Parameter Type | 1 | ||
Change Parameter Type locks : Locks to statementLocksFactory : StatementLocksFactory in method public KernelTransactionImplementation(operations StatementOperationParts, schemaWriteGuard SchemaWriteGuard, labelScanStore LabelScanStore, indexService IndexingService, schemaState UpdateableSchemaState, recordState TransactionRecordState, providerMap SchemaIndexProviderMap, neoStores NeoStores, statementLocksFactory StatementLocksFactory, hooks TransactionHooks, constraintIndexCreator ConstraintIndexCreator, headerInformationFactory TransactionHeaderInformationFactory, commitProcess TransactionCommitProcess, transactionMonitor TransactionMonitor, storeLayer StoreReadLayer, legacyIndexTransactionState LegacyIndexTransactionState, pool Pool<KernelTransactionImplementation>, constraintSemantics ConstraintSemantics, clock Clock, tracer TransactionTracer, procedureCache ProcedureCache, context NeoStoreTransactionContext, txTerminationAwareLocks boolean) in class org.neo4j.kernel.impl.api.KernelTransactionImplementation | From | To | |
Move Attribute | 3 | ||
Move Attribute private locksManager : Locks from class org.neo4j.kernel.impl.api.KernelTransactionImplementation to private locksManager : Locks from class org.neo4j.kernel.impl.locking.StatementLocksFactory | From | To | |
Move Attribute private deferringLocks : boolean from class org.neo4j.kernel.impl.api.KernelTransactionImplementation to private deferringLocks : boolean from class org.neo4j.kernel.impl.locking.StatementLocksFactory | From | To | |
Move Attribute private deferringLocks : boolean from class org.neo4j.kernel.impl.api.KernelTransactions to private deferringLocks : boolean from class org.neo4j.kernel.impl.locking.StatementLocksFactory | From | To | |
Extract Class | 2 | ||
Extract Class org.neo4j.kernel.impl.locking.StatementLocksFactory from class org.neo4j.kernel.impl.api.KernelTransactionImplementation | From | To | |
Extract Class org.neo4j.kernel.impl.locking.StatementLocksFactory from class org.neo4j.kernel.impl.api.KernelTransactions | From | To | |
Rename Attribute | 1 | ||
Rename Attribute locksManager : Locks to statementLocksFactory : StatementLocksFactory in class org.neo4j.kernel.impl.api.KernelTransactionImplementation | From | To | |
Change Attribute Type | 1 | ||
Change Attribute Type locksManager : Locks to statementLocksFactory : StatementLocksFactory in class org.neo4j.kernel.impl.api.KernelTransactionImplementation | From | To | |
Rename Parameter | 1 | ||
Rename Parameter locks : Locks to statementLocksFactory : StatementLocksFactory in method public KernelTransactionImplementation(operations StatementOperationParts, schemaWriteGuard SchemaWriteGuard, labelScanStore LabelScanStore, indexService IndexingService, schemaState UpdateableSchemaState, recordState TransactionRecordState, providerMap SchemaIndexProviderMap, neoStores NeoStores, statementLocksFactory StatementLocksFactory, hooks TransactionHooks, constraintIndexCreator ConstraintIndexCreator, headerInformationFactory TransactionHeaderInformationFactory, commitProcess TransactionCommitProcess, transactionMonitor TransactionMonitor, storeLayer StoreReadLayer, legacyIndexTransactionState LegacyIndexTransactionState, pool Pool<KernelTransactionImplementation>, constraintSemantics ConstraintSemantics, clock Clock, tracer TransactionTracer, procedureCache ProcedureCache, context NeoStoreTransactionContext, txTerminationAwareLocks boolean) in class org.neo4j.kernel.impl.api.KernelTransactionImplementation | From | To |